KKR vs GT Playing 11, IPL 2025: Andre Russell to be Dropped? Kolkata Knight Riders vs Gujarat Titans Predicted Lineups

By MyKhel Staff

KKR vs GT Playing 11: The reigning champions Kolkata Knight Riders will host Gujarat Titans in the 39th fixture of the IPL 2025 on Monday (April 21) at the Eden Gardnes.

This season, KKR have been struggling from the outset due to their inconsistency. After playing seven games, they have secured only three wins and are placed seventh with 6 points. In their most recent match, they failed to chase a modest target of 112 against PBKS. In contrast, GT are currently leading the table with 10 points. They have won five out of seven matches and boast the best net run rate (+0.984) among all participating teams.

KKR vs GT H2H Record

This match marks the 4th encounter between the Knights and the Titans. So far, GT hold the advantage with 2 victories, while KKR have managed to win once. One game concluded without a result, which happened last year.

KKR vs GT Team News, Injury Update

Kolkata Knight Riders

KKR have not reported any major injuries and are likely to play their strongest XI. Their batting this season relies heavily on the top and upper-middle order, particularly on Rahane, Narine, and Venkatesh Iyer. Opener Quinton de Kock has struggled apart from a good show against RR. However, Rinku Singh finding form brings hope to KKR’s lower-order batting woes.

As they have had difficulties against spin this season, KKR must be wary with their shot selection against the Titans’ top-class spinners like Sai Kishore and Rashid Khan.

Andre Russell can be dropped while Rovman Powell may be given a nod. Also, Vaibhav Arora was hit on the fingers during a training session but the pacer is expected to play this match. For the Knight Riders, South African wicketkeeper Quinton de Kock hasn't been at his best as well but the Proteas star is likely to feature in this one as well.

Gujarat Titans

GT hold the best average (52.37) and strike rate (162.4) against spin among all teams this season. Their top three also have the highest combined average (49.72) this year. Their performance against the top spin unit of IPL 2025 will be decisive. Jos Buttler will be crucial, not only for his excellent form but also because of his favorable strike rate against KKR’s bowlers. The Englishman also has two centuries at this venue against the Knights.

However, KKR spinners maintain the best economy rate (6.51 RPO) this season. If they bowl first, it will be a tough test for GT’s top-order. Kagiso Rabada remains unavailable as he returned home for personal reasons.

KKR vs GT Playing 11: Kolkata Knight Riders vs Gujarat Titans Predicted Lineups

KKR: Quinton de Kock (wk), Sunil Narine, Ajinkya Rahane (c), Angkrish Raghuvanshi, Venkatesh Iyer, Rinku Singh, Ramandeep Singh, Rovman Powell, Anrich Nortje, Harshit Rana, Varun Chakravarthy

KKR Impact Player: Vaibhav Arora

GT: Shubman Gill (c), Sai Sudharsan, Jos Buttler (wk), Sherfane Rutherford, Shahrukh Khan, Rahul Tewatia, Arshad Khan, Rashid Khan, Ravisrinivasan Sai Kishore, Mohammed Siraj, Prasidh Krishna

GT Impact Player: Washington Sundar
